N2 - The analysis of electrodynamic properties of two-dimensional (2D) Bragg resonators of coaxial-geometry realizing 2D distributed feedback was carried out with diffraction effects taken into account. Such resonators represent coaxial waveguide sections with a shallow double-periodic corrugation, which provides mutual coupling of four partial waves. It is shown that the high selectivity of 2D Bragg resonators over the azimuthal mode index can be explained by different behavior of the normal symmetrical and non-symmetrical waves near the Bragg resonance in an unbound double-periodic corrugated waveguide.
